Canes Venatici
Definition
1) Canes Venatici is a small northern constellation located near the tail of the Great Bear (Ursa Major). It is known as the "Hunting Dogs" in Latin and represents two dogs following the constellation Bootes the Herdsman.
2) In astronomy, Canes Venatici is home to several notable celestial objects, including the Whirlpool Galaxy (M51) and the radiant for the meteor shower known as the Quadrantids.
3) The name Canes Venatici is derived from Latin and translates to "hunting dogs," symbolizing the celestial dogs accompanying a hunter figure in the night sky.
